WebbPalliative care is a team-based approach to care for people with serious illness that is appropriate at any age/stage of illness. It can be provided along with curative treatment. Palliative care: Is focused on improving the quality of life for individuals facing serious and limiting illness, and their care partners. Objective: The goal of this paper is to define cultural competence and present a practical framework to address crosscultural challenges that emerge in the clinical … Webb18 sep. 2024 · Diversity among nurses can help them do the following: Become more culturally sensitive to patient needs. Increase patient trust and confidence in their care. More thoroughly assess the healthcare needs of different minority groups. Advocate better for patients with an understanding of culture, customs, food, and religious views.

WebbA core aim of cultural competence in health care is achieving health equity, which means providing the same level of quality care to every patient, regardless of race, ethnicity, cultural background, language, or level of health literacy.
